本文对Tailwind CSS框架进行了深入评测和应用实践,特别是针对Vue.js的使用。Tailwind CSS是一个实用主义的CSS框架,它提供了一系列的预设类,可以快速构建出美观且响应式的用户界面。在Vue.js项目中使用Tailwind CSS,可以提高开发效率,减少重复代码,使项目更加整洁和易于维护。
在现代的Web开发中,CSS框架已经成为了开发者的重要工具,它们提供了一套预定义的样式和组件,可以帮助开发者快速构建出美观且功能强大的网站,在众多的CSS框架中,Tailwind CSS无疑是一个独特的存在,它以实用主义为核心,提供了一套全面的响应式设计工具,使得开发者可以更加专注于业务逻辑,而不是样式细节。
Tailwind CSS的最大特点就是它的实用主义设计理念,它没有提供任何预设的样式,也没有提供任何UI组件,相反,它提供了一套预定义的类名,这些类名可以直接应用于HTML元素,以实现各种样式效果,这种方式虽然看起来有些反人类,但实际上却非常灵活和强大,因为开发者可以根据自己的需求,自由组合这些类名,以实现任何想要的样式效果。
Tailwind CSS的另一个特点是它的响应式设计,它提供了一套全面的响应式设计工具,包括断点、颜色、字体、间距、边距等各种设计元素,这些工具都是基于实际的物理尺寸,而不是抽象的像素值,因此可以确保在不同设备上都能提供一致的用户体验。
在使用Tailwind CSS的过程中,我发现它非常适合用于构建复杂的后台管理系统,因为这些系统通常需要处理大量的数据和复杂的交互,而且对样式的要求也非常高,使用Tailwind CSS,我可以快速地构建出美观且功能强大的界面,而不需要花费大量的时间去处理样式细节。
Tailwind CSS也有一些缺点,由于它的类名数量非常多,因此学习成本相对较高,由于它没有提供任何预设的样式和UI组件,因此对于一些简单的项目,使用Tailwind CSS可能会显得过于复杂,由于它的类名是全局的,因此如果不小心使用了错误的类名,可能会导致样式混乱。
Tailwind CSS是一个非常强大的CSS框架,它以实用主义为核心,提供了一套全面的响应式设计工具,虽然它的学习成本较高,但只要熟练掌握,就可以大大提高开发效率,对于复杂的后台管理系统,我强烈推荐使用Tailwind CSS。